Position Summary...
Level I (X2) — Systems & Infrastructure Engineer II |AI Security & Safety Engineering (IC) Location: Chennai, India Level: X2 – Entry to Mid-Level IC Reports to: Director – AI Security & Safety Engineering Role Summary The job of an AI Security Software Engineer requires a robust combination of traditional software engineering, cybersecurity, and artificial intelligence/machine learning (AI/ML) expertise. These roles focus on designing, building, testing, and monitoring AI systems to protect them from sophisticated attacks and ensure compliance. This is a foundational IC role with a growth path into advanced AI safety engineering, MLSecOps, and threat-informed prompt testing. Core Technical Skills • Software Engineering and Programming: o Proficiency in Python (required), plus Java, C++, or Go o Secure coding practices and awareness of OWASP Top 10 o SDLC awareness and DevSecOps tooling integration (CI/CD pipelines) • AI/ML Knowledge: o Familiarity with ML fundamentals and frameworks (PyTorch, TensorFlow, scikit-learn) o Understanding threats like evasion, poisoning, model inversion, prompt injection • Cybersecurity & Hacking: o Exposure to vulnerability scanning and threat modeling o Understanding of containerized/cloud environments (Docker, Kubernetes, GCP/Azure) o Basic grasp of cryptography, authentication, and IAM principles Specialization and Application • Data Security and Privacy: o Understanding data access controls, input sanitation, and training data protection o Awareness of federated learning and differential privacy • Security Architecture & Incident Response: o Understanding Zero Trust principles o Participate in AI-specific IR workflows and postmortem reviews • Compliance and Ethics: o Familiar with GDPR, HIPAA, ISO 27001, and NIST AI RMF basics o Recognize algorithmic fairness, bias, and safety guardrails Essential Soft Skills • Problem-solving and analytical thinking • Communication and collaboration across engineering and policy teams • Adaptability and willingness to continuously learn emerging AI risks Responsibilities • Contribute to CI test corpora (e.g., SafetyPrompts, JailbreakBench) • Implement prompt validators and redaction logic (e.g., Presidio) • Develop telemetry fields and logging scaffolds (e.g., prompt_hash, model_version) • Assist in incident reproduction, red-team tracking, and triage • Write test harness code and review pull requests for safety tests Required Qualifications • Bachelor’s of Engineering with Specialization in Cybersecurity / AI
• Completed minimum 6 months Internship working on A Security & Safety Engineering Projects • Experience in Python, CI/CD, test writing, JSON/YAML schema Preferred Qualifications • Prompt safety experimentation or basic classifier integration • Prior exposure to red-team scenarios or PII protection workflows • Interest in applied ML security or MLSecOps
What you'll do...
Demonstrates uptodate expertise and applies this to the development execution and improvement of action plans by providing expert advice and guidance to others in the application of information and best practices supporting and aligning efforts to meet customer and business needs and building commitment for perspectives and rationales Provides and supports the implementation of business solutions by building relationships and partnerships with key stakeholders identifying business needs determining and carrying out necessary processes and practices monitoring progress and results recognizing and capitalizing on improvement opportunities and adapting to competing demands organizational changes and new responsibilities Models compliance with company policies and procedures and supports company mission values and standards of ethics and integrity by incorporating these into the development and implementation of business plans using the Open Door Policy and demonstrating and assisting others with how to apply these in executing business processes and practices Infrastructure Design Requires knowledge of Software architecture Distributed systems Scalability Design patterns Disaster Recovery Tech Stacks NonFunctional Requirements Security standards frameworks and methodologies System Security Plan SSP Security Risk and Compliance Review SRCR etc To assist in design of solutions such that the processes applications work in tandem for specific componentsmodules of a productsystem Evaluate tradeoffs while designing a component basis the business requirements Support in conversion of HLDHigh Level Design to create detailed design for specific modules components of a productsystem Adhere to securitycompliance norms and frameworks while creating design for specific modules components of a productsystemplatform Technology Solution Automation Requires knowledge of Automation tools and technologies Scripting Languages To automate repetitive tasks by using automation tools Assist in identification of repetitive tasks that can be automated Infrastructure Maintenance Requires knowledge of Infrastructure maintenance tools and methodologies Infrastructure maintenance plans and schedule Infrastructure performance metrics To assist in performing routine maintenance tasks for infrastructure systems for example backups patch management and hot fixes Maintain backup media Maintain a log file of all system transactions Requirement And Scoping Analysis Requires knowledge of Traceability matrix Risk analysis methodologies Cost Analysis Business objectives Classification of requirements User stories To understand the BusinessStakeholderTechnical requirements and assist in analyzing the existing solutions to address the needs in case of agile methodology for the iteration Prepare requirement traceability matrix and maintain traceability between business requirements functional requirements design and test cases Contribute to the creation of user stories for componentmodulesimple requirements for example based on scalability etc For agile methodology Security Domain Acumen Requires knowledge of Competitive landscapes Existing enterprise systems and technologies Domainspecific market standards Relevant technologies and environments Domainspecific methodologies tools and processes To demonstrate awareness of various principles ways of working and subdomainspecific terminologies Compares the maturity of products services and processes within a subdomain against others in the industry Coding Requires knowledge of Coding standards and guidelines Coding languages Eg JavaScript Python C etc frameworksEg ActiveX Net Cocoa Android application framework etc toolsEg Mondaycom Linx Embold etc and Platforms Eg Microsoft Azure AWS Apple IOS etc Quality Safety and Security PCI etc standards Emerging tools and technologies Telemetry To adhere to all relevant coding guidelines Ex code review processes code branching strategies reusability etc while writingconfiguring code Createconfigure minimalistic Less Complex Highly Robust and high quality code for a componentmodule under guidance Maintain records by documenting program development and revisions Stay updated on the prevalent coding languages and frameworks in the industry outside the immediate scope of delivery Identify repetitive and routine tasks in Continuous IntegrationContinuous Delivery CICD Testing or any other process that can be automated Implement telemetry features as required under guidance Apply security policy requirements to componentmodule during code developmentconfiguration Issue Resolution Requires knowledge of Issue resolution techniques Escalation scale parameters To use Issue resolution techniques to resolve issues of low complexity Create and maintain a repository of all the issues raised Capacity Management Requires knowledge of Capacity management Current and future business requirements Walmart service levels Computing resources Infrastructure performance Infrastructure growth plans To provide suggestions to for rightsizing IT resources to meet current and future business requirements in a costeffective manner Analyze IT resource utilization Rightsize applications to make sure service levels can be met Assist in creating capacity plans that covers current use Configuration Management Requires knowledge of Configuration management tools and processes Configuration and release management in environments To identify required processes tools and baseline products for configuration including software models plans and documents for low complexity project Configure new Virtual Machines VMs to handle email intranet VLANs firewalls VPNs and core business applications running on the cloud
Respect the Individual: Demonstrates and encourages respect for others drives a positive associate and customermember experience for all embraces differences in people cultures ideas and experiences supports workplaces where associated feel seen and connected through a culture of belonging so all associates thrive and perform contributes to an environment allowing everyone to bring their best selves to work
Respect the Individual: Demonstrates engagement and commitment to the team developing others through feedback coaching mentoring and developmental opportunities and recognizes others contributions and accomplishments
Respect the Individual: Builds strong and trusting relationships with team members and business partners works collaboratively to achieve objectives communicates with impact and listens attentively to a range of audiences and demonstrates energy and positivity for own work
Act with Integrity: Maintains and promotes the highest standards of integrity ethics and compliance models the Walmart values and leads by example to foster our culture supports Walmarts goal of becoming a regenerative company by making a positive impact for associates customers and the world around us eg creating a sense of belonging eliminating waste participating in local giving
Act with Integrity: Follows the law our code of conduct and company policies and encourages others to do the same supports an environment where associates feel comfortable sharing concerns reinforces our culture of nonretaliation listens to concerns raised by associates and takes action acts with accountability for achieving results in a way that is consistent with our values
Act with Integrity: Is consistently humble selfaware honest and transparent
Serve our Customers and Members Delivers results while putting the customermember first and applying an omnimerchant mindset and acts with an Every Day LowCost mindset to drive value and Every Day Low Prices for customersmembers
Serve our Customers and Members Adopts a broad perspective that considers data analytics customermember insights and different parts of the business when making plans
Strive for Excellence: Consistently raises the bar and seeks to improve demonstrates curiosity and a growth mindset seeks feedback asks thoughtful questions supports innovation and intelligent risktaking and exhibits resilience in the face of setbacks
Strive for Excellence: Implements and supports continuous improvements and willingly embraces new digital tools and ways of working
Minimum Qualifications...
__Outlined below are the required minimum qualifications for this position. If none are listed, there are no minimum qualifications. __
Option 1: Bachelor's degree in computer science, information technology, engineering, information systems, cybersecurity, or related area Option 2: 3 years’ experience in systems and infrastructure engineering or related area at a technology, retail, or data-driven company.
Preferred Qualifications...
__Outlined below are the optional preferred qualifications for this position. If none are listed, there are no preferred qualifications. __
Certification in Security+, GISF, or GSEC.
Primary Location...
Tower 1, Part Of 1st, 2nd To 4th Flrs, Intl Tech Park Radial Road (radial It Park Pvt Ltd), , India